Skip to content

Directory The Cook Book

Tag: Nepalese restaurant in Portsmouth

The Palace Restaurant & Venue | 35 Station Rd Aldershot GU11 1BA United Kingdom

The Palace Restaurant & Venue Address: 35 Station Rd Aldershot GU11 1BA United Kingdom Phone: +44 1252 345777 | Portsmouth | UK